I started writing in May 2019 with fanfiction for the television show Monk. I wrote or co-wrote 15 stories for Monk and 5 (or almost 5âmy original is still a WIP) for When Calls the Heart. In that time, I cannot tell you the copious hours I spent not only researching the showsâ canons but also the historical realities of the topics I tackled. In âMr. Monk and the Monster Maker,â for instance, I did a deep dive into transhumanism and CRISPR technology, as well as the subtopic of âediting outâ genetic variations such as those that cause Down syndrome. When writing When Calls the Heart fiction, I studied everything from the type of car Lucas drove at the time to the main players in American bootlegging in 1920. We wonât mention how close some of my storylines came to what eventually aired on television. In all, I have written around 1.8 million words of story since 2019, so I have learned a lot along the way.
But today is a new day. As of this juncture, Iâve left creating new fanfiction behind (I will still finish Hearts Heal Stronger, but it will take some time) and am pursuing my debut novel, Josiahâs War. Writing professionally, Iâve discovered, is an entirely different ballgame from writing fanfiction. Fanfiction was a marvelous training ground, and Iâll always appreciate my loyal readers over the years for teaching me so much about storytelling. But now comes the discipline.
Iâve never been great with punctuation. I tend to be wordy (no comments, @kelleysgirl), and until now my stories have focused on characters created by other writers. So bringing you Josiah Pierce and Emma Lawrence is something I am very excited to do.
But given that this is historical fiction, it requires a massive amount of research and documentation to support the story. AI is helpful in pointing me in the right direction (particularly Claude), but each fact must be sourced because AI also hallucinates facts, which can cause a lot of rework if youâre not careful.
As an aside and for the record, I have rules set up with AI that it is not to do any writing or plotting for me. If it tries to get out of line, I stop it. As a human writer, I understand emotion is more than language patterns, and where I take my characters isnât something AI could have dreamt up. Still, for research and for my prototype coverâwhich I will have done by a human artist if I publish independently or which will be replaced by a publishing companyâitâs a useful tool.
Regardless, this venture is a lot of work. On this X page I will be sharing some of that research. History is fascinating, and I hope to bring it to lifeâalong with its questions and answersâwith Josiahâs War sometime within the next year or so (traditional publishing can take years, so weâll see where God takes this). I hope youâll stay with me on this journey and look forward to conversing with those who are interested.

Some Holocaust deniers use the fact that concentration camp tattoos only go to 6 digits as proof that 6 million Jews couldn't have died in the Holocaust.
Tattooed numbers were used only in one German Nazi camp: Auschwitz. These tattoos were assigned exclusively to prisoners who were registered in the camp. Out of approximately 1.3 million people deported to Auschwitz, only about 400,000 were registered as prisoners and given numbers.
The vast majority of Jews murdered in Auschwitz, around one million people, were never registered; they were murdered in gas chambers right upon arrival and received no tattooed number.
Moreover, tattoos were not exclusive to Jewish prisoners. Others, including Poles, Roma, Soviet POWs, and others, were also registered and tattooed at Auschwitz. Other concentration camps had entirely different systems for identifying prisoners and did not use tattoos at all.
To suggest that every Jewish victim of the Holocaust received a tattooed number, and to use the limited length of those numbers to cast doubt on the scale of the genocide, is not only factually false. This kind of distortion is a deliberate tactic used by Holocaust deniers to insult the memory of victims.
In the world of deniers, the suffering of real human beings is reduced to cynical wordplay and harassment. Denying is an assault on memory, truth, and human dignity.
